Student to Faculty Ratio

The student to faculty ratio at Yeshivath Viznitz is an impressive 10 to 1. That’s quite good when you compare it to the national average of 15 to 1. This is a good sign that students at the school will have more opportunities for one-on-one interactions with their professors.

Percent of Full-Time Faculty

When estimating how much access students will have to their teachers, some people like to look at what percentage of faculty members are full time. This is because part-time teachers may not have as much time to spend on campus as their full-time counterparts.

The full-time faculty percentage at Yeshivath Viznitz is 57%. This is higher than the national average of 47%.

Freshmen Retention Rate

The freshmen retention rate of 97% tells us that most first-year, full-time students like Yeshivath Viznitz enough to come back for another year. This is a fair bit higher than the national average of 68%. That’s certainly something to check off in the good column about the school.

Time to Degree

The on-time graduation rate for someone pursuing a bachelor’s degree is typically four years. This rate at Yeshivath Viznitz for first-time, full-time students is 69%, which is better than the national average of 33.3%.

What Does Yeshivath Viznitz Cost?

$16,772 Net Price

The overall average net price of Yeshivath Viznitz is $16,772. The affordability of the school largely depends on your financial need since net price varies by income group. The net price is calculated by adding tuition, room, board and other costs and subtracting financial aid. Note that the net price is typically less than the published price for a school. Yeshivath Viznitz is a private not-for-profit institution located in Monsey, New York. Monsey is a good match for students who enjoy the safety and convenience of the suburbs. Get more details about the location of Yeshivath Viznitz.

Yeshivath Viznitz Majors

2 Majors With Completions
198 Undergraduate Degrees

In the latest year of available data, students from 2 majors graduated from Yeshivath Viznitz. The following table lists the most popular undergraduate majors along with the average salary graduates from those majors make.

Most Popular Majors Completions Average Salary of Graduates
Religious Studies 99 NA
Multi-Disciplinary Studies 99 NA
